Hamas recognizes Israel's Right to Exist
There are some sentences I never thought I'd read outside of Science Fiction. This is one of them.
There is no way to know how long this will last. It may simply be a PR stunt to facilitate getting foreign aid. But previously, this was unimaginable. And who knows what will happen, once you have crossed the rubicon
Hamas has accepted Israel's right to exist and would be prepared to nullify its charter, which calls for the destruction of Israel, Aziz Dwaik, Hamas's most senior representative in the West Bank, said on Wednesday.Hamas, you may recall, has historically been dedicated to the destruction of Israel and the establishment of an Islamic state in its place. They have fired thousands of rockets into Israel and killed many, many innocent civilians. But now, in control of the Palestinian territories, they are realizing that there may be more to gain by accepting Israel and actually considering peace.

Deep Thought of the Day: Who Would Jesus Bomb?
Well, I started off my day reading Ward's critique of James Dobson, so why not fan the flames of theology a little more?
While driving home from work the other day, I came across an interesting bumper sticker. (Photo is not mine, but looks similar.)

Clever, right? Turns the "What Would Jesus Do?" thing on its head, and makes you consider the apparent irony of a "Christian" nation attacking another country. I respect a good slogan.
But the more I thought about it, the more I realized it really misses something else about Jesus. Yes, He is the "Prince of Peace" and he raised a hand against no one at his trial. But this is the same Jesus who overturned the moneychangers tables and whipped them out of the Temple. It is the same Jesus who said...

Do not suppose that I have come to bring peace to the earth. I did not come to bring peace, but a sword.This Jesus is no pacifist. And in the imagery we see of Him in Revelation, it is even more stark.
Matthew 10:34
I saw heaven standing open and there before me was a white horse, whose rider is called Faithful and True. With justice he judges and makes war. His eyes are like blazing fire, and on his head are many crowns. He has a name written on him that no one knows but he himself. He is dressed in a robe dipped in blood, and his name is the Word of God. The armies of heaven were following him, riding on white horses and dressed in fine linen, white and clean. Out of his mouth comes a sharp sword with which to strike down the nations. "He will rule them with an iron scepter." He treads the winepress of the fury of the wrath of God Almighty.Now, I am not saying diplomacy is not generally preferable to combat, or that war is not something to be avoided, when it can. But I am saying that we need to always be careful of our stereotyped, narrow views of Jesus as either the perfect pacifist, the glowering judge, the liberal activist, the conservative avenger, or anything else. He is bigger than our prejudices, and bigger than our assumptions.
Revelation 19:11-15
So, let the warmongers fear calling for blood in His name, and let the peaceniks fear calling for retreat in His name.
